How to maintain Dog Bed
Maintaining a dog bed is crucial for your pets health and comfort. Here are some guidelines to ensure your dogs bed remains clean and durable.Cleaning Frequency
- Clean the bed cover weekly and the entire bed monthly.
- Use mild, pet-safe detergents to avoid skin irritations.
- Regular vacuuming helps remove hair and dirt.
Material Care
- Follow the care instructions provided by the manufacturer.
- Spot clean memory foam beds to avoid water damage.
- Use a lint roller to remove hair from non-washable parts.
Odor Control
- Apply baking soda to the bed before vacuuming to neutralize odors.
- Use pet-safe fabric sprays for a fresh scent.
- Ensure the bed is thoroughly dry after washing to prevent mold.
Protection
- Use a waterproof cover to protect against accidents.
- Keep the bed in a dry, shaded area to prevent sun damage.
- Rotate the bed regularly to ensure even wear.
Inspection
- Regularly check for signs of damage, such as holes or flattened areas.
- Replace the bed if it no longer provides adequate support.
- Ensure zippers and seams are intact to maintain the beds integrity.
